Output faf59153d71c86cdc3fa4a330d0bf89bc2962afe467ee04213e340abc39b7f25:112

value
65152
script pubkey
OP_0 OP_PUSHBYTES_20 2f406657bb98b923c6b366f378cf86382390e720
address
bc1q9aqxv4amnzuj834nvmeh3nux8q3epeeqlh47th
transaction
faf59153d71c86cdc3fa4a330d0bf89bc2962afe467ee04213e340abc39b7f25